This newly created role is a unique opportunity to lead the design and optimization of material flow systems for our new manufacturing facility. Whether you aspire to be a technical expert or future leader, this role will position you for long-term growth and development. You’ll work cross-functionally to design efficient material delivery systems, reduce waste, and support a high-performing production environment. 

 

Primary Planning and Start-Up Responsibilities 

  • Develop and maintain PFEP (Plan for Every Part) spreadsheets to support material planning and delivery. 
  • Design and implement call systems (Kanban) to ensure timely and efficient material replenishment. 
  • Lead the design and setup of kitting and supermarket systems to streamline material handling. 
  • Conduct WIP (Work-In-Process) reduction studies to improve flow and reduce inventory. 
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to design ergonomic and efficient line-side material displays. 
  • Support layout planning and material conveyance strategies for new production lines. 
  • Provide input to project plans, schedules, and capital budgets related to material flow systems. 

 

Primary Ongoing Production Responsibilities 

  • Monitor and continuously improve material flow processes to support production efficiency and quality. 
  • Analyze production data to identify bottlenecks and lead improvement initiatives. 
  • Support the implementation of lean manufacturing principles across material handling systems. 
  • Collaborate with production, quality, and engineering teams to troubleshoot and resolve material flow issues. 
  • Evaluate and recommend new equipment or systems to enhance material delivery and storage. 
  • Maintain documentation and standards for material flow processes and systems.
